From mboxrd@z Thu Jan 1 00:00:00 1970
From: bugzilla-daemon@freedesktop.org
Subject: [Bug 96877] Bioshock Infinite: LLVM triggered Diagnostic Handler:
Illegal instruction detected: Operand has incorrect register class.
Date: Sun, 10 Jul 2016 09:08:12 +0000
Message-ID:
Bug ID
96877
Summary
Bioshock Infinite: LLVM triggered Diagnostic Handler: Illegal=
instruction detected: Operand has incorrect register class.
Product
Mesa
Version
git
Hardware
Other
OS
All
Status
NEW
Severity
normal
Priority
medium
Component
Drivers/Gallium/radeonsi
Assignee
dri-devel@lists.freedesktop.org
Reporter
haagch@frickel.club
QA Contact
dri-devel@lists.freedesktop.org
This happens on my HD 7970M.
"Very Low" graphics settings work fine but trying to start with &=
quot;Medium"
settings throws this error before it even gets to the menu.
The files are bit too big for bugzilla I think, so
Here is an stderr log with R600_DEBUG=3D"vs,ps,gs,tes,tcs":
http://haagch.frick=
el.club/files/err.txt.gz
Here is an apitrace that causes the error:
http://=
haagch.frickel.club/files/bioshock.i386.trace.xz
Happened with latest mesa git and llvm 3.9.0svn_r274975 and now with
3.9.0svn_r275008 too.